Offline mr.WHO

  • 29
R3 single mission "Apocalypse" Screenshot
Yeah, I know but I don't want to have 30-60 scripts for 30-60 explosions.
I wan't 3-10 sripts for 3-10 explosions that wil be blowing many times.

I tried to connet explosion-effect with has-arrived/departed-delay for wing with 99 waves. I have a wing that arriving, and then departing. But this's working only for first wave.

R3 single mission "Apocalypse" Screenshot
Use a repeating event then. Or if that's too regular for your liking you could try something like this.

every-time
-and
--has-time-elapsed
---When the bombardment starts
---ExplosionTimeVariable(0)
--<
---NumberOfExplosionsSoFarVariable(0)
---Number of Explosions you want
-Explosion-effect
-- +
---lowest x value for the explosion location.
---rand
----0
----Some value
-- +
---lowest y value for the explosion location.
---rand
----0
----Some value
-- +
---lowest z value for the explosion location.
---rand
----0
----Some value
--All the other explosion effect settings
-modify-variable
--ExplosionTimeVariable(0)
--Rand
---0
---3
-modify-variable
--NumberOfExplosionsSoFarVariable(0)
-- +
---NumberOfExplosionsSoFarVariable(0)
---1


Okay. Now to explain it. The event above will make a set number of explosions occur in the bounding box you've specified using the X+somevalue settings at random intervals of about 0-3 seconds.
